I've seen complains about bots, busy servers, and many other things. But face it, bots will always be here, and most likely the servers will always be busy. The thing that Joymax needs to crack down on is not the botters or the busy servers, it's the sexual predators out there.
Being part of the small female percentage of the population that plays this game, this is a big deal (atleast in my opinion). Just yesterday, I met two male predators (but not all are male), both wanted my email. Their reason? To become better "friends". I personally never give out any personal information, even to many of my friends in this game. Therefore I didn't give them my email and I'm lucky I didn't. Later I found out they were going to send me naked pictures of themselves and if they got my MSN, they were going to show me them doing "Stuff" (I'm sure you can figure out what) through their webcams.
Though many adults play this game, I'd have to say that most of the game's role players are kids. I didn't give them my email, but what if Sally (a 14 year old from Iowa) did?
This game is supposed to be fun, but with many of these "predators" floating around it ruins the enjoyable atmosphere of the game. If I had kids, there is no way I would expose them to this game.
In all the other Mass multiplayer games I have played, there has always been a crackdown on these "predators" as we call them. And even if Joymax may not be able to catch them all, just banning one or two out of the game may save three or four kids from what these "perverts" are planning.
Please crackdown on this, joymax
This is to spread the awareness of things that are happening in this game.
